/usr/bin/ld: cannot find -lboost_system-mt-s /usr/bin/ld: cannot find -lboost_filesystem-mt-s /usr/bin/ld: cannot find -lboost_program_options-mt-s /usr/bin/ld: cannot find -lboost_thread-mt-s collect2: error: ld returned 1 exit status make: *** [cag

cagecoin linux compile:


sudo apt-get install qt4-qmake libqt4-dev build-essential libboost-dev libboost-system-dev \
        libboost-filesystem-dev libboost-program-options-dev libboost-thread-dev \
        libssl-dev libdb++-dev libminiupnpc-dev

Solution:

 sed -i s/"BOOST_LIB_SUFFIX=-mt-s"/"#BOOST_LIB_SUFFIX=-mt-s"/ cagecoin-qt.pro
 



qmake
make

 -L/home/ubuntu/build/openssl-1.0.1g -lssl -lcrypto -ldb_cxx -lboost_system-mt-s -lboost_filesystem-mt-s -lboost_program_options-mt-s -lboost_thread-mt-s -lQtGui -lQtCore -lpthread
/usr/bin/ld: cannot find -lboost_system-mt-s
/usr/bin/ld: cannot find -lboost_filesystem-mt-s
/usr/bin/ld: cannot find -lboost_program_options-mt-s
/usr/bin/ld: cannot find -lboost_thread-mt-s
collect2: error: ld returned 1 exit status
make: *** [cagecoin-qt] Error 1

#troubleshoot
 ld -lboost_system-mt-s --verbose



libboost-filesystem-dev
libboost-system-dev
libboost-program-options-dev
libboost-thread-dev
attempt to open /usr/x86_64-linux-gnu/lib64/libboost_system-mt-s.so failed
attempt to open /usr/x86_64-linux-gnu/lib64/libboost_system-mt-s.a failed
attempt to open //usr/local/lib/x86_64-linux-gnu/libboost_system-mt-s.so failed
attempt to open //usr/local/lib/x86_64-linux-gnu/libboost_system-mt-s.a failed
attempt to open //usr/local/lib64/libboost_system-mt-s.so failed
attempt to open //usr/local/lib64/libboost_system-mt-s.a failed
attempt to open //lib/x86_64-linux-gnu/libboost_system-mt-s.so failed
attempt to open //lib/x86_64-linux-gnu/libboost_system-mt-s.a failed
attempt to open //lib64/libboost_system-mt-s.so failed
attempt to open //lib64/libboost_system-mt-s.a failed
attempt to open //usr/lib/x86_64-linux-gnu/libboost_system-mt-s.so failed
attempt to open //usr/lib/x86_64-linux-gnu/libboost_system-mt-s.a failed
attempt to open //usr/lib64/libboost_system-mt-s.so failed
attempt to open //usr/lib64/libboost_system-mt-s.a failed
attempt to open //usr/local/lib/libboost_system-mt-s.so failed
attempt to open //usr/local/lib/libboost_system-mt-s.a failed
attempt to open //lib/libboost_system-mt-s.so failed
attempt to open //lib/libboost_system-mt-s.a failed
attempt to open //usr/lib/libboost_system-mt-s.so failed
attempt to open //usr/lib/libboost_system-mt-s.a failed
ld: cannot find -lboost_system-mt-s



sudo apt-get install qt4-default qt4-qmake libqt4-dev build-essential libboost-dev libboost-system-dev libboost-filesystem-dev libboost-program-options-dev libboost-thread-dev libdb++-dev libssl-dev libminiupnpc-dev libminiupnpc8
 


Tags:

usr, bin, ld, lboost_system, mt, lboost_filesystem, lboost_program_options, lboost_thread, cagcagecoin, linux, compile, sudo, apt, install, qt, qmake, libqt, dev, essential, libboost, filesystem, libssl, libdb, libminiupnpc, sed, quot, boost_lib_suffix, cagecoin, ubuntu, openssl, lssl, lcrypto, ldb_cxx, lqtgui, lqtcore, lpthread, troubleshoot, verbose, _, gnu, lib, libboost_system, default,

Latest Articles

  • Linux how to compile binary with static sharedobjects embedded instead of dynamic to use on multi-distributions and avoid glibc compatiblity issues
  • /bin/sh: msgfmt: not found error solution on Linux Compilation Ubuntu Debian Mint Centos
  • Mikrotik RouterOS CHR/ISO Basic and Quick Setup Howto Guide
  • qemu 4 compilation options
  • CentOS 7 8 PXEBoot Netinstall Not Working Solution "Pane is dead "new value non-exisetnt xfs filesystem is not valid as a default fs type"
  • CentOS 6 EOL yum repo won't work Error: Cannot find a valid baseurl for repo: base Solution
  • CentOS 7 8 How To Disable SELinux
  • Wordpress How To Add Featured Image To Post in Hueman Theme
  • kdenlive full reset how to erase all config files
  • CentOS 7 8 yum error Trying other mirror. To address this issue please refer to the below wiki article
  • Microsoft Teams Linux - Calendar Doesn't Work Missed Meetings!
  • Scanner not working in Linux Ubuntu Fedora Mint Debian over the network? Use sane-airscan!
  • How To Boot, Install and Run Windows 2000 on QEMU-KVM
  • bash cannot execute permission denied
  • Huion and Wacom Tablets How To Install in Linux Mint / Ubuntu and make the stylus work properly
  • ffmpeg how to cut certain parts of video out
  • ffmpeg how to concat and join two video clips
  • mencoder instead of ffmpeg to join or concatenate video files with different audio streams
  • Linux How To Stop Missing Drive from Halting Boot Process in fstab
  • How To Replace Audio Track of Video using ffmpeg